Commit History

Author SHA1 Message Date
  Adam Ierymenko 24e30a684b A bunch of little nit-picky header and name cleanup. 5 years ago
  Adam Ierymenko 27ab88db1e little stuff 5 years ago
  Adam Ierymenko f21ecb3762 Yet more major and very nit-picky refactoring for performance, etc. Also use std::atomic<> now with a TODO to implement a shim if we ever do need to build this on a pre-c++11 compiler. 5 years ago
  Adam Ierymenko df346a6df6 Work in progress... clean up memcpy and create an annotation for that, lots more porting to new Buf/Protocol code, etc. 5 years ago
  Adam Ierymenko 59da359b06 More porting to new Buf system. 5 years ago
  Adam Ierymenko 91ce4c4ea6 Refactoring protocol marshal/unmarshal code... 5 years ago
  Adam Ierymenko 5c6bf9d0a4 Wiring up addroot/removeroot 5 years ago
  Adam Ierymenko eef70e198b Version 2.x notice updates and other boring stuff. 6 years ago
  Adam Ierymenko 3fbfad5585 cleanup 6 years ago
  Adam Ierymenko 627533cf48 . 6 years ago
  Adam Ierymenko 19899de5a6 . 6 years ago
  Adam Ierymenko 6267c67888 A bunch of cleanup and refactoring toward 2.x 6 years ago
  Adam Ierymenko ed2024285d More Go boilerplate. 6 years ago
  Adam Ierymenko f12370c348 more opt 6 years ago
  Adam Ierymenko 6f6138c500 Merge relicensing change from dev 6 years ago
  Adam Ierymenko 52a166a71f Relicense: GPLv3 -> ZeroTier BSL 1.1 6 years ago
  Adam Ierymenko 521d371b5d A bunch more refactoring to rip out obsolete stuff related to old root system and general cleanup. 6 years ago
  Adam Ierymenko d7a31088ba Cleanup, warning removal, cppcheck informed cleanup. 6 years ago
  Joseph Henry 0e597191b8 Updated licenses for 2019 7 years ago
  Adam Ierymenko 65c07afe05 Copyright updates for 2018. 8 years ago
  Adam Ierymenko 16613ab5fb Clean up remote tracing code, add per-network remote trace settings, add remote trace level, and make local trace output readable again. 8 years ago
  Adam Ierymenko b9e1d53d7a Minor cleanup. 8 years ago
  Adam Ierymenko d2415dee00 Cleanup. 8 years ago
  Adam Ierymenko 355cce3938 Rename Utils::snprintf due to it being a #define on one platform. 8 years ago
  Adam Ierymenko 1b68d6dbdc License header update. 8 years ago
  Adam Ierymenko 4e4fd51117 boring doc stuff 10 years ago
  Adam Ierymenko c1a53a2653 ARP cache and responder agent code for use in netcon and iOS. 10 years ago
  Adam Ierymenko b11ffc9635 Integrate Hashtable into Multicaster, where @mwarning found heaviest std::map() overhead. 10 years ago
  Adam Ierymenko ddebe2d4c7 Network controller CRUD... :P 10 years ago
  Adam Ierymenko a86300c58f Network build fixes and cleanup of remaining internal references to _tap 10 years ago